Transaction 50f06dbfcb1447a5d238f51e35f26a5378402aa5e07ff983ed5801252373343c

4 Input
2 Outputs
  • 50f06dbfcb1447a5d238f51e35f26a5378402aa5e07ff983ed5801252373343c:0
  • value  38693
    address  12HqZQ29Z1T9yWrsh5DU5CRFSTmZU3FYbF
  • 50f06dbfcb1447a5d238f51e35f26a5378402aa5e07ff983ed5801252373343c:1
  • value  28357403
    address  17YYMwdSzi8yrFb3Fh1TMRAMQFdTd6U7Br